Mon Sep 16 15:21:26 UTC 2024: ## Biden Calls for Increased Security for Trump After Second Assassination Attempt

**Washington, D.C.** – President Joe Biden urged Congress on Monday to provide the Secret Service with additional resources, citing two failed assassination attempts against former President Donald Trump in just over two months.

“The Service needs more help. And I think Congress should respond to their need,” Biden told reporters outside the White House. He emphasized the agency’s need to determine whether more personnel are required.

The call for enhanced security comes after Ryan Wesley Routh, 58, was arrested on Sunday for allegedly attempting to assassinate Trump while he was playing golf in South Florida. Routh, who appears to have shifted from Trump supporter to critic, has expressed anti-Trump sentiments online and even encouraged Iran to kill him, according to excerpts of his book about the Ukraine war.

House Speaker Mike Johnson also voiced support for increased security for Trump, though his past record in fulfilling such promises remains questionable.
